Appendix I: Round Two Part I Operational Tasks
Top 14 Competencies out of
(Competencies 1 thru 10 agreed by 100% panel)
***presented below in alpha order***
1. Budgeting Skills
2. Collaborative/Teamwork Skills 3. General Communication Skills 4. Interpersonal Communication Skills 5. Organization Skills
6. Planning Skills 7. Policy‐making Skills 8. Presentation Skills
9. Project Management Skills 10. Strategic Planning Skills
(Competencies 11 thru 14 have been submitted by panel member as “very critical” – highest rating 4 and agreed by 100% panel)
11. *Detail‐oriented, yet able to multi‐task 12. *Handle confidential information
13. *Legal knowledge associated with administering online education programs 14. *Critical thinking skills
* provided by panel member during last Round (#2)
Note: the following competencies was agreed by 80% of panel members as also a necessity for administrators.
• Change Agent Skills • Data Analysis Skills
• Knowledge of Distance Learning Field • Knowledge of Support Services • Public Relations Skills
